Known for its white sand beaches and green waters, the Henderson Beach State Park is a well-equipped state beach in Western Florida.

One of the unique features of this state park is the abundance of boardwalks that lead to a myriad of different locations and land types in the park. One provides access to the beach and activities like swimming, fishing, and sunbathing. There are pavilions available for those wish to have a picnic or grill their food. One boardwalk is actually a nature trail which features a rare look at the sand dunes and the various and abundant wildlife of the dune ecosystem. Campsites are also available, all of which are full facility sites with water and electricity hookups.
